#f44f49 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f44f49 is composed of 95.7% red, 31%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.6% magenta, 70.1%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 2.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#f44f49 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e92 with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f44f49 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f44f49 has RGB values of R:244, G:79,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.7,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16011081.

Shades and Tints of #f44f49
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030000 is the darkest color, while #fef0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#f44f49
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29b9b is the less saturated color, while #fb4842 is the most saturated one.
